fold¹ /fold; fəʊld/v 1. [t] to bend a piece of paper, cloth etc so that one part covers another part 折叠:◇she folded her clothes and put them on a chair. 她将自己的衣服叠好放在椅子上。◇fold sth in two/in half (=fold it across the middle) 对折: fold the paper in two. 将纸对折。 2. also 又作 fold up [i,t] to make something, for example a table or chair, smaller by bending it or closing it, so that it can be stored [将桌、椅等]折起:◇be sure to fold up the ironing board when you're finished. 烫衣板用完后务须折叠起来。◇a folding chair 折椅 3. fold your arms to bend your arms, so that they are resting across your chest 交叉[交叠]双臂 4. [i] also 又作 fold up if a company folds, it is unsuccessful and cannot continue [企业]倒闭 |
